Why Lisbon Chooses Outdoor BESS for Energy Resilience
With increasing solar adoption and fluctuating energy demands, Lisbon's outdoor BESS installations act like a "power bank" for the city. These systems store excess solar energy during peak production and release it when needed. For example, a 2023 project in Parque das Nações reduced grid stress by 18% during summer peaks.
Key Applications of BESS in Urban Settings
- Grid Stability: Smoothing voltage fluctuations caused by solar/wind variability
- Peak Shaving: Cutting energy costs by avoiding price surges during high-demand periods
- Emergency Backup: Providing up to 72 hours of power for critical infrastructure
Case Study: Solar + BESS in Lisbon's Public Infrastructure
In 2022, Lisbon upgraded 12% of its streetlights with hybrid solar-BESS units. The results?
Metric | Before | After |
---|---|---|
Energy Costs | €42,000/month | €28,500/month |
CO2 Reduction | 12 tons/month | 31 tons/month |
Grid Dependency | 89% | 63% |

The Future: AI-Optimized BESS for Smart Cities
Lisbon's next-phase projects integrate predictive analytics. By analyzing weather patterns and usage trends, AI can:
- Forecast energy needs with 92% accuracy
- Automatically dispatch stored power during shortages
- Extend battery lifespan by 15-20%

FAQ: Lisbon's BESS Projects
- Q: How long do BESS batteries last?A: 10-15 years with proper maintenance.
- Q: Can BESS work during blackouts?A: Yes – systems switch to island mode within milliseconds.
